Friday, May 24: Last Day of School - A Full Day of Reflection and Farewells

The last day of school for all students at Owyhee High School is set for Friday, May 24, and it’s a full day of classes.

Saturday, May 25: Owyhee High School Graduation - A Moment of Triumph

The culmination of years of hard work, dedication, and countless memories, the graduation ceremony for Owyhee High School's senior class is set for Saturday, May 25, at 11:00 a.m. This significant event will be held at the Extra Mile Arena on the BSU Campus, where family, friends, and faculty will gather to celebrate the incredible achievements of our graduating students.
